Uttar Pradesh Congress Appoints Dalit Thinker HL Dusadh as Ideology Department Chairman

The Uttar Pradesh Congress Committee has made a significant appointment by naming noted Dalit thinker and author HL Dusadh as the chairman of its Vichar Vibhag, or ideology department. This strategic move was officially confirmed on Thursday and represents a deliberate effort to strengthen the party's intellectual foundation in India's most populous state.

Leadership Approval and Appointment Process

The appointment followed a formal recommendation from Avinash Pandey, the All India Congress Committee general secretary in charge of Uttar Pradesh. State Congress president Ajay Rai subsequently granted his approval, making the appointment official through proper party channels. This process underscores the importance the party leadership places on ideological development within its state unit.

Background and Journey of HL Dusadh

Born in 1963 in Uttar Pradesh's Deoria district, HL Dusadh spent more than three decades in West Bengal, where he cultivated his intellectual perspective and professional expertise. His early attempt to create meaningful social content came in 1990 when he proposed a television serial on the life and struggles of Dr. B.R. Ambedkar to Doordarshan. When this project failed to secure approval, Dusadh made a pivotal decision in 1997 to leave his corporate career behind.

Since abandoning his corporate position, Dusadh has dedicated himself entirely to writing and advancing the Bahujan movement. His commitment to social justice and equality has defined his professional trajectory for over two decades.

Intellectual Contributions and Academic Engagement

Since the year 2000, Dusadh has concentrated his work on the critical theme of diversity, delivering lectures at prestigious institutions including Banaras Hindu University, Jawaharlal Nehru University, and numerous other universities across India. His writings have regularly appeared in several leading Hindi newspapers, establishing him as a prominent voice on issues of social and economic inequality.

Often referred to as the 'Diversity Man of India,' Dusadh has authored multiple volumes that include annual diversity yearbooks and a comprehensive series addressing contemporary socio-economic challenges facing marginalized communities.

Organizational Leadership and Mission

Beyond his writing and speaking engagements, Dusadh founded the Bahujan Diversity Mission, an organization that advocates for equitable representation across economic, political, and social spheres. This initiative reflects his deep commitment to creating structural change and promoting inclusive policies that benefit all segments of society.

Strategic Significance for Uttar Pradesh Congress

Party leaders have expressed confidence that Dusadh's appointment will significantly strengthen ideological engagement and policy thinking within the state unit. His expertise on diversity issues and his understanding of social dynamics are expected to inform the party's approach to addressing the complex challenges facing Uttar Pradesh.

The appointment comes at a crucial time for the Congress party in Uttar Pradesh, where it seeks to rebuild its political presence and connect with diverse voter constituencies. By bringing a respected Dalit intellectual into a leadership position, the party aims to demonstrate its commitment to inclusive governance and thoughtful policy development.
